1. 05 9月, 2008 1 次提交
    • R
      ppc44x: Unification of virtex5 pp440 boards · e07f4a80
      Ricardo Ribalda Delgado 提交于
      This patch provides an unificated way of handling xilinx v5 ppc440 boards.
      
      It unificates 3 different things:
      
      1) Source code
      A new board called ppc440-generic has been created. This board includes
      a generic tlb initialization (Maps the whole memory into virtual) and
      defines board_pre_init, checkboard, initdram and get_sys_info weakly,
      so, they can be replaced by specific functions.
      
      If a new board needs to redefine any of the previous functions
      (specific initialization) it can create a new directory with the
      specific initializations needed. (see the example ml507 board).
      
      2) Configuration file
      Common configurations are located under configs/xilinx-ppc440.h, this
      header file interpretes the xparameters file generated by EDK and
      configurates u-boot in correspondence. Example: if there is a Temac,
      allows CMD_CONFIG_NET
      Specific configuration are located under specific configuration file.
      (see the example ml507 board)
      
      3) Makefile
      Some work has been done in order to not duplicate work in the Main
      Makefile. Please see the attached code.
      
      In order to support new boards they can be implemented in the next way:
      
      a) Simple Generic Board  (90% of the time)
      Using EDK generates a new xparameters.h file, replace
      ppc440-generic/xparameters.h  and run make xilinx-ppc440-generic_config
      && make
      
      b) Simple Boards with special u-boot parameters (9 % of the time)
      Create a new file under configs for it (use ml507.h as example) and
      change your paramaters. Create a new Makefile paragraph and compile
      
      c) Complex boards (1% of the time)
      Create a new folder for the board, like the ml507
      
      Finally, it adds support for the Avnet FX30T Evaluation board, following
      the new generic structure:
      
      Cheap board by Avnet for evaluating the Virtex5 FX technology.
      
      This patch adds support for:
       - UartLite
       - 16MB Flash
       - 64MB RAM
      
      Prior using U-boot in this board, read carefully the ERRATA by Avnet
      to solve some memory initialization issues.
      Signed-off-by: NRicardo Ribalda Delgado <ricardo.ribalda@uam.es>
      Signed-off-by: NStefan Roese <sr@denx.de>
      e07f4a80
  2. 31 8月, 2008 4 次提交
  3. 28 8月, 2008 1 次提交
  4. 27 8月, 2008 3 次提交
  5. 20 8月, 2008 2 次提交
  6. 15 8月, 2008 1 次提交
  7. 11 8月, 2008 2 次提交
  8. 06 8月, 2008 1 次提交
  9. 30 7月, 2008 1 次提交
    • J
      Add support for the hammerhead (AVR32) board · 5c374c9e
      Julien May 提交于
      The Hammerhead platform is built around a AVR32 32-bit microcontroller
      from Atmel.  It offers versatile peripherals, such as ethernet, usb
      device, usb host etc.
      
      The board also incooperates a power supply and is a Power over Ethernet
      (PoE) Powered Device (PD).
      
      Additonally, a Cyclone III FPGA from Altera is integrated on the board.
      The FPGA is mapped into the 32-bit AVR memory bus. The FPGA offers two
      DDR2 SDRAM interfaces, which will cover even the most exceptional need
      of memory bandwidth. Together with the onboard video decoder the board
      is ready for video processing.
      
      For more information see: http:///www.miromico.com/hammerheadSigned-off-by: NJulien May <mailinglist@miromico.ch>
      [haavard.skinnemoen@atmel.com: various small fixes and adaptions]
      Signed-off-by: NHaavard Skinnemoen <haavard.skinnemoen@atmel.com>
      5c374c9e
  10. 18 7月, 2008 1 次提交
    • R
      ppc4xx: ML507 Board Support · 086511fc
      Ricardo Ribalda Delgado 提交于
      The Xilinx ML507 Board is a Virtex 5 prototyping board that includes,
      	among others:
      	-Virtex 5 FX FPGA (With a ppc440x5 in it)
      	-256MB of SDRAM2
      	-32MB of Flash
      	-I2C Eeprom
      	-System ACE chip
      	-Serial ATA connectors
      	-RS232 Level Conversors
      	-Ethernet Transceiver
      
      This patch gives support to a standard design produced by EDK for this
      board: ppc440, uartlite, xilinx_int and flash
      
      - Includes Changes propossed by Stefan Roese and Michal Simek
      Signed-off-by: NRicardo Ribalda Delgado <ricardo.ribalda@uam.es>
      Acked-by: NStefan Roese <sr@denx.de>
      086511fc
  11. 16 7月, 2008 1 次提交
  12. 13 7月, 2008 2 次提交
  13. 11 7月, 2008 1 次提交
  14. 11 6月, 2008 1 次提交
  15. 09 6月, 2008 1 次提交
  16. 27 5月, 2008 1 次提交
  17. 10 5月, 2008 4 次提交
  18. 08 5月, 2008 1 次提交
  19. 29 4月, 2008 1 次提交
  20. 14 4月, 2008 1 次提交
  21. 01 4月, 2008 2 次提交
  22. 28 3月, 2008 4 次提交
  23. 27 3月, 2008 1 次提交
  24. 16 3月, 2008 1 次提交
  25. 15 3月, 2008 1 次提交